## Step 4: Migrate the Fuel-Usage Report Job

The Cartwheel fleet fuel-usage report moves from the nightly cron host to the scheduled-jobs cluster in this step. Disable the legacy cron entry first, then register the new job definition and confirm one successful dry run before enabling production output. Report recipients and aggregation windows are unchanged; only the execution environment differs. If the dry run fails, re-enable the cron entry and escalate. The new job reads the following configuration values at startup.

deployment values, yahag-tawef:
ZORWYN_HOST=zorwyn.tolvaqlabs.internal
ZORWYN_PORT=9300

## Deployment

Shrinkray is a CLI for batch image resizing, deployed as a single static binary with no network listeners; all input arrives via the filesystem paths passed on the command line. For review purposes, note that it drops privileges after reading its config, writes only inside the declared output directory, and refuses symlinked inputs by default. Configuration is loaded once at startup from a read-only mount, never reloaded. The values we ship in the production deployment are as follows.

config for kafof-bawef:
holath:
  log_level: debug
  metrics_host: metrics.holath.qorvelsys.internal
  pin: 2191
  pool_size: 32

Account recovery for the Lanternfall crash-report pipeline must be done carefully, since the ingest account also signs symbolication requests. First confirm the outage is credential-related by checking the dead-letter queue on the Quillhaven broker. Then open the recovery console, select the pipeline service account, and choose "restore from escrow." The console will ask you to type, exactly and in lowercase, the recovery passphrase below.

unlock words, hahip-baduf: holwyn-istath-julvan

# Break-Glass: Catalog Cache Invalidation

Scope: the Pinrow product catalog at Veldstone Retail. If stale prices persist after a purge and the Hollowmere invalidation queue is wedged, use break-glass to flush the edge tier directly. Contractors: get verbal sign-off from the catalog lead first. Steps: open the Hollowmere admin shell, select emergency-flush, confirm the tenant, and run it once — repeated flushes thrash the origin. Access is logged and expires after 20 minutes. Unseal the admin shell with the passphrase below.

recovery phrase for kahop-tajog: istix-casvan